Fresh off the biggest win of his career, Devin Clark is eyeing the top 15 of the light heavyweight division. Clark (12-4 MMA, 6-4 UFC) upset Alonzo Menifield at UFC 250, bouncing him from the ranks of the unbeaten in a hard-fought battle. Clark is currently serving a medical suspension for a damaged left orbital bone, but he’s looking to pick up right where he left off as soon as he’s cleared. Winner of his last two fights, Clark is targeting a bout with Mauricio Rua (26-11-1 MMA, 10-9-1 UFC), who’s currently slated to complete his trilogy with Antonio Rogerio Nogueira on July 25 in Abu Dhabi.
